20090115085 | SYSTEM AND METHOD FOR TWO-SHOT MOLDING CRASH PAD - A system and a method for two-shot molding a crash pad, in which a passenger side air bag (PAB) door region is more flexible than other regions is disclosed. The system includes a first resin supply unit, a second resin supply unit, a temperature sensor mounted on a predetermined position of a mold, adjacent to a target material interface, and a controller for controlling a time at which to supply the second resin into the passenger side air bag region based on a detection signal from the temperature sensor. This system is cost effective and can maintain a uniform interface between different types of materials. | 05-07-2009 |
20090317648 | Apparatus and Method for Producing Resin Product - An apparatus produces a resin product which includes a first resin layer partially covered with a second resin layer so that a boundary line between the first and second resin layers is visible from the outside. The apparatus may include a first mold side having a recess, a second mold side configured and dimensioned to enclose the recess of the first mold side, a slide core movably fitted in the recess of the first mold side, which may be movable toward the second mold side to an extracted position to define a first cavity, and may be movable rearward to a retracted position after a first resin is injected into the first cavity to form the first resin layer, thus defining a second cavity into which a second resin is injected to form the second resin layer, the slide core including a dam dimensioned and configured to form a groove in the first resin layer during the formation of the first resin layer, wherein the dame partially positioned in the groove during the formation of the second resin layer, a first resin supply unit for supplying the first cavity with the first resin, and/or a second resin supply unit for supplying the second cavity with the second resin. The resin product produced by the apparatus is excellent in appearance, and obviates the post-processing formation of a tear line. Methods of forming the resin product are also described. | 12-24-2009 |

20100133793 | Airbag Apparatus for Vehicles - Disclosed herein is an airbag apparatus for vehicles, which is capable of minimizing the loss of pressure of an airbag cushion. The airbag housing of the airbag apparatus accommodates an airbag cushion which is deployed through an opening. An airbag deployment door is placed to face the opening and separated from the cut notch of a crash pad cover when the airbag cushion is deployed. A chute is connected to a surface of the airbag deployment door through a curved hinge portion which is placed to be parallel to the sidewall of the airbag housing. | 06-03-2010 |

20110123658 | MOLD AND METHOD FOR PRODUCING TWO-COLOR INJECTION-MOLDED PARTS - A mold and a method for producing two-color injection-molded parts involves simultaneous injection of two kinds of molding material, in which a pressure difference between two kinds of molding materials is induced so that one of the molding materials is infiltrated into and bonded to the other molding material during solidification. The method for producing two-color injection-molded parts may include simultaneously injecting a first material and a second material to a first gate and a second gate to be filled in a first cavity and a second cavity, and closing the second gate such that the first molding material, which is not solidified, pushes a slide mold provided between a first mold block and a second mold block using a holing pressure of the first gate and is infiltrated into an unsolidified layer of the second molding material and solidified. | 05-26-2011 |
20120139214 | METHOD FOR MANUFACTURING CRASH PAD FOR VEHICLE AND CRASH PAD MANUFACTURED THEREBY - A method for manufacturing a crash pad for a vehicle, may include (a) preparing a die including an upper die and a lower die for forming a first cavity for a Passenger Air Bag (PAB) door and a second cavity for a crash pad body, between the upper die and the lower die, (b) fixing a skin foam on an upper surface of the lower die, (c) moving the upper die in an upward direction in a predetermined distance and filling the first cavity for the PAB door with a first material and the second cavity for the crash pad body with a second material, (d) moving the upper die in a downward direction to compress the first and second materials against the lower die, while the first and second cavities may be filled with the first material and the second material, and (e) extracting a core of the PAB door and the crash pad body integrally formed with the skin foam from the die. | 06-07-2012 |

20140162019 | APPARATUS AND METHOD FOR MANUFACTURING CRASH PAD - An apparatus and method for manufacturing a crash pad with a foaming layer formed by injecting a foaming solution between a core and a skin are disclosed. The apparatus includes a first mold and a second mold used to form the skin by injecting molten resin of a skin material into a skin forming cavity when the first and second molds are combined. In addition, a third mold and the fourth mold form the core by injecting molten resin of a core material into a core forming cavity when the third and fourth molds are combined. The first mold has a vacuum aperture in an inner surface of the first mold to adsorb and fix a thread to implement a stitch before the forming of the skin, and the vacuum aperture exerts a vacuum suctioning force to absorb and fix via a vacuum pressure applied from a vacuum pressure providing unit. | 06-12-2014 |
